Title :
Design and measurement of a hybrid dielectric resonator antenna

Abstract :
In this paper, a rectangular hybrid dielectric resonator antenna (HDRA) is proposed. In the proposed design, the structure uses a combination of a rectangular dielectric resonator (DR) fed by a microstrip line through dog-bone shape slot. This dog-bone slot works as a feed circuit for the DR. Here two different DR materials are used and compared. The study is also made by increasing the thickness of the DRs. Based on the above design concept, an antenna prototype for X-band applications is successfully designed, fabricated and tested.
